What are the top historical places and other sights to visit in Santa Flavia?
Landmarks like Soluntum Ruins and Basilica Soluntina Sant’Anna in Santa Flavia might be worth a visit. Natural beauty is on display at Sant’Elia Beach, Aciddara, and Lido Porto di Spagna. Additionally, you’ll find Mondello Beach in the area.

What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
“Heritage hotel” is more common in Asia and Europe, while “historic hotel” is a term often used in the U.S. but over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and actual building of historic hotels tend to be what’s most important. For a heritage hotel, it’s mainly the cultural value and how it inspired the community.
